    Anic Inc. engages in the gaming business worldwide. Its character-collecting mobile RPG, King’s Raid game is offered in various languages, including Korean, English, Japanese, Vietnamese, Thai, Portuguese, French, German, Russian, Spanish, Simplified Chinese, and Traditional Chinese. The company was formerly known as Vespa Inc. and changed its name to Anic Inc. in March 2024. Anic Inc. was founded in 2013 and is based in Seoul, South Korea.
